sigpy.mri.rf.trajgrad.
epi
(fov, n, etl, dt, gamp, gslew, offset=0, dirx=-1, diry=1)[source]¶ Basic EPI single-shot trajectory designer.
Parameters: - fov (float) – imaging field of view in cm.
- n (int) – # of pixels (square). N = etl*nl, where etl = echo-train-len and nl = # leaves (shots). nl default 1.
- etl (int) – echo train length.
- dt (float) – sample time in s.
- gamp (float) – max gradient amplitude in mT/m.
- gslew (float) – max slew rate in mT/m/ms.
- offset (int) – used for multi-shot EPI goes from 0 to #shots-1
- dirx (int) – x direction of EPI -1 left to right, 1 right to left
- diry (int) – y direction of EPI -1 bottom-top, 1 top-bottom
Returns: (g, k, t, s) tuple containing
- g - (array): gradient waveform [mT/m]
- k - (array): exact k-space corresponding to gradient g.
- time - (array): sampled time
- s - (array): slew rate [mT/m/ms]
Return type: tuple
